  2. Django Deprecation Timeline
  3. ===========================
  4. This document outlines when various pieces of Django will be removed or altered
  5. in a backward incompatible way, following their deprecation, as per the
  6. :ref:`deprecation policy <internal-release-deprecation-policy>`. More details
  7. about each item can often be found in the release notes of two versions prior.
  8. .. _deprecation-removed-in-5.1:
  9. 5.1
  10. ---
  11. See the :ref:`Django 4.2 release notes <deprecated-features-4.2>` for more
  12. details on these changes.
  13. * The ``BaseUserManager.make_random_password()`` method will be removed.
  14. * The model's ``Meta.index_together`` option will be removed.
  15. * The ``length_is`` template filter will be removed.
  16. * The ``django.contrib.auth.hashers.SHA1PasswordHasher``,
  17. ``django.contrib.auth.hashers.UnsaltedSHA1PasswordHasher``, and
  18. ``django.contrib.auth.hashers.UnsaltedMD5PasswordHasher`` will be removed.
  19. * The model 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.CICharField``,
  20. 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.CIEmailField``, and
  21. 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.CITextField`` will be removed. Stub fields
  22. will remain for compatibility with historical migrations.
  23. * The 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.CIText`` mixin will be removed.
  24. * The ``map_width`` and ``map_height`` attributes of ``BaseGeometryWidget``
  25. will be removed.
  26. * The ``SimpleTestCase.assertFormsetError()`` method will be removed.
  27. * The ``TransactionTestCase.assertQuerysetEqual()`` method will be removed.
  28. * Support for passing encoded JSON string literals to ``JSONField`` and
  29. associated lookups and expressions will be removed.
  30. .. _deprecation-removed-in-5.0:
  31. 5.0
  32. ---
  33. See the :ref:`Django 4.0 release notes <deprecated-features-4.0>` for more
  34. details on these changes.
  35. * The ``SERIALIZE`` test setting will be removed.
  36. * The undocumented ``django.utils.baseconv`` module will be removed.
  37. * The undocumented ``django.utils.datetime_safe`` module will be removed.
  38. * The default value of the ``USE_TZ`` setting will change from ``False`` to
  39. ``True``.
  40. * The default sitemap protocol for sitemaps built outside the context of a
  41. request will change from ``'http'`` to ``'https'``.
  42. * The ``extra_tests`` argument for ``DiscoverRunner.build_suite()`` and
  43. ``DiscoverRunner.run_tests()`` will be removed.
  44. * The ``django.contrib.postgres.aggregates.ArrayAgg``, ``JSONBAgg``, and
  45. ``StringAgg`` aggregates will return ``None`` when there are no rows instead
  46. of ``[]``, ``[]``, and ``''`` respectively.
  47. * The ``USE_L10N`` setting will be removed.
  48. * The ``USE_DEPRECATED_PYTZ`` transitional setting will be removed.
  49. * Support for ``pytz`` timezones will be removed.
  50. * The ``is_dst`` argument will be removed from:
  51. * ``QuerySet.datetimes()``
  52. * ``django.utils.timezone.make_aware()``
  53. * ``django.db.models.functions.Trunc()``
  54.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ncSecond()``
  55.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ncMinute()``
  56.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ncHour()``
  57.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ncDay()``
  58.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ncWeek()``
  59.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ncMonth()``
  60.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ncQuarter()``
  61. * ``django.db.models.functions.TruncYear()``
  62. * The ``django.contrib.gis.admin.GeoModelAdmin`` and ``OSMGeoAdmin`` classes
  63. will be removed.
  64. * The undocumented ``BaseForm._html_output()`` method will be removed.
  65. * The ability to return a ``str``, rather than a ``SafeString``, when rendering
  66. an ``ErrorDict`` and ``ErrorList`` will be removed.
  67. See the :ref:`Django 4.1 release notes <deprecated-features-4.1>` for more
  68. details on these changes.
  69. * The ``SitemapIndexItem.__str__()`` method will be removed.
  70. * The ``CSRF_COOKIE_MASKED`` transitional setting will be removed.
  71. * The ``name`` argument of ``django.utils.functional.cached_property()`` will
  72. be removed.
  73. * The ``opclasses`` argument of
  74. ``django.contrib.postgres.constraints.ExclusionConstraint`` will be removed.
  75. * The undocumented ability to pass ``errors=None`` to
  76. ``SimpleTestCase.assertFormError()`` and ``assertFormsetError()`` will be
  77. removed.
  78. * ``django.contrib.sessions.serializers.PickleSerializer`` will be removed.
  79. * The usage of ``QuerySet.iterator()`` on a queryset that prefetches related
  80. objects without providing the ``chunk_size`` argument will no longer be
  81. allowed.
  82. * Passing unsaved model instances to related filters will no longer be allowed.
  83. * ``created=True`` will be required in the signature of
  84. ``RemoteUserBackend.configure_user()`` subclasses.
  85. * Support for logging out via ``GET`` requests in the
  86. ``django.contrib.auth.views.LogoutView`` and
  87. ``django.contrib.auth.views.logout_then_login()`` will be removed.
  88. * The ``django.utils.timezone.utc`` alias to ``datetime.timezone.utc`` will be
  89. removed.
  90. * Passing a response object and a form/formset name to
  91. ``SimpleTestCase.assertFormError()`` and ``assertFormsetError()`` will no
  92. longer be allowed.
  93. * The ``django.contrib.gis.admin.OpenLayersWidget`` will be removed.
  94. * The ``django.contrib.auth.hashers.CryptPasswordHasher`` will be removed.
  95. * The ``"django/forms/default.html"`` and
  96. ``"django/forms/formsets/default.html"`` templates will be removed.
  97. * The ability to pass ``nulls_first=False`` or ``nulls_last=False`` to
  98. ``Expression.asc()`` and ``Expression.desc()`` methods, and the ``OrderBy``
  99. expression will be removed.
  100. .. _deprecation-removed-in-4.1:
  101. 4.1
  102. ---
  103. See the :ref:`Django 3.2 release notes <deprecated-features-3.2>` for more
  104. details on these changes.
  105. * Support for assigning objects which don't support creating deep copies with
  106. ``copy.deepcopy()`` to class attributes in ``TestCase.setUpTestData()`` will
  107. be removed.
  108. * ``BaseCommand.requires_system_checks`` won't support boolean values.
  109. * The ``whitelist`` argument and ``domain_whitelist`` attribute of
  110. ``django.core.validators.EmailValidator`` will be removed.
  111. * The ``default_app_config`` module variable will be removed.
  112. * ``TransactionTestCase.assertQuerysetEqual()`` will no longer automatically
  113. call ``repr()`` on a queryset when compared to string values.
  114. * ``django.core.cache.backends.memcached.MemcachedCache`` will be removed.
  115. * Support for the pre-Django 3.2 format of messages used by
  116. ``django.contrib.messages.storage.cookie.CookieStorage`` will be removed.
  117. .. _deprecation-removed-in-4.0:
  118. 4.0
  119. ---
  120. See the :ref:`Django 3.0 release notes <deprecated-features-3.0>` for more
  121. details on these changes.
  122. * ``django.utils.http.urlquote()``, ``urlquote_plus()``, ``urlunquote()``, and
  123. ``urlunquote_plus()`` will be removed.
  124. * ``django.utils.encoding.force_text()`` and ``smart_text()`` will be removed.
  125. * ``django.utils.translation.ugettext()``, ``ugettext_lazy()``,
  126. ``ugettext_noop()``, ``ungettext()``, and ``ungettext_lazy()`` will be
  127. removed.
  128. * ``django.views.i18n.set_language()`` will no longer set the user language in
  129. ``request.session`` (key ``django.utils.translation.LANGUAGE_SESSION_KEY``).
  130. * ``alias=None`` will be required in the signature of
  131. ``django.db.models.Expression.get_group_by_cols()`` subclasses.
  132. * ``django.utils.text.unescape_entities()`` will be removed.
  133. * ``django.utils.http.is_safe_url()`` will be removed.
  134. See the :ref:`Django 3.1 release notes <deprecated-features-3.1>` for more
  135. details on these changes.
  136. * The ``PASSWORD_RESET_TIMEOUT_DAYS`` setting will be removed.
  137. * The undocumented usage of the :lookup:`isnull` lookup with non-boolean values
  138. as the right-hand side will no longer be allowed.
  139. * The ``django.db.models.query_utils.InvalidQuery`` exception class will be
  140. removed.
  141. * The ``django-admin.py`` entry point will be removed.
  142. * The ``HttpRequest.is_ajax()`` method will be removed.
  143.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 encoding format of cookies values used by
  144. ``django.contrib.messages.storage.cookie.CookieStorage`` will be removed.
  145.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 password reset tokens in the admin site (that
  146. use the SHA-1 hashing algorithm) will be removed.
  147.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 encoding format of sessions will be removed.
  148.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 ``django.core.signing.Signer`` signatures
  149. (encoded with the SHA-1 algorithm) will be removed.
  150.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 ``django.core.signing.dumps()`` signatures
  151. (encoded with the SHA-1 algorithm) in ``django.core.signing.loads()`` will be
  152. removed.
  153. * Support for the pre-Django 3.1 user sessions (that use the SHA-1 algorithm)
  154. will be removed.
  155. * The ``get_response`` argument for
  156. ``django.utils.deprecation.MiddlewareMixin.__init__()`` will be required and
  157. won't accept ``None``.
  158. * The ``providing_args`` argument for ``django.dispatch.Signal`` will be
  159. removed.
  160. * The ``length`` argument for ``django.utils.crypto.get_random_string()`` will
  161. be required.
  162. * The ``list`` message for ``ModelMultipleChoiceField`` will be removed.
  163. * Support for passing raw column aliases to ``QuerySet.order_by()`` will be
  164. removed.
  165. * The model ``NullBooleanField`` will be removed. A stub field will remain for
  166. compatibility with historical migrations.
  167. * ``django.conf.urls.url()`` will be removed.
  168. * The model 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.JSONField`` will be removed. A
  169. stub field will remain for compatibility with historical migrations.
  170. * ``django.contrib.postgres.forms.JSONField``,
  171. 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.jsonb.KeyTransform``, and
  172. 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.jsonb.KeyTextTransform`` will be removed.
  173. * The ``{% ifequal %}`` and ``{% ifnotequal %}`` template tags will be removed.
  174. * The ``DEFAULT_HASHING_ALGORITHM`` transitional setting will be removed.
  175. .. _deprecation-removed-in-3.1:
  176. 3.1
  177. ---
  178. See the :ref:`Django 2.2 release notes <deprecated-features-2.2>` for more
  179. details on these changes.
  180. * ``django.utils.timezone.FixedOffset`` will be removed.
  181. * ``django.core.paginator.QuerySetPaginator`` will be removed.
  182. * A model's ``Meta.ordering`` will no longer affect ``GROUP BY`` queries.
  183. * ``django.contrib.postgres.fields.FloatRangeField`` and
  184. ``django.contrib.postgres.forms.FloatRangeField`` will be removed.
  185. * The ``FILE_CHARSET`` setting will be removed.
  186. * ``django.contrib.staticfiles.storage.CachedStaticFilesStorage`` will be
  187. removed.
  188. * ``RemoteUserBackend.configure_user()`` will require ``request`` as the first
  189. positional argument.
  190. * Support for ``SimpleTestCase.allow_database_queries`` and
  191. ``TransactionTestCase.multi_db`` will be removed.
  192. .. _deprecation-removed-in-3.0:
  193. 3.0
  194. ---
  195. See the :ref:`Django 2.0 release notes<deprecated-features-2.0>` for more
  196. details on these changes.
  197. * The ``django.db.backends.postgresql_psycopg2`` module will be removed.
  198. * ``django.shortcuts.render_to_response()`` will be removed.
  199. * The ``DEFAULT_CONTENT_TYPE`` setting will be removed.
  200. * ``HttpRequest.xreadlines()`` will be removed.
  201. * Support for the ``context`` argument of ``Field.from_db_value()`` and
  202. ``Expression.convert_value()`` will be removed.
  203. * The ``field_name`` keyword argument of ``QuerySet.earliest()`` and
  204. ``latest()`` will be removed.
  205. See the :ref:`Django 2.1 release notes <deprecated-features-2.1>` for more
  206. details on these changes.
  207. * ``django.contrib.gis.db.models.functions.ForceRHR`` will be removed.
  208. * ``django.utils.http.cookie_date()`` will be removed.
  209. * The ``staticfiles`` and ``admin_static`` template tag libraries will be
  210. removed.
  211. * ``django.contrib.staticfiles.templatetags.static()`` will be removed.
  212. * The shim to allow ``InlineModelAdmin.has_add_permission()`` to be defined
  213. without an ``obj`` argument will be removed.
  214. .. _deprecation-removed-in-2.1:
  215. 2.1
  216. ---
  217. See the :ref:`Django 1.11 release notes<deprecated-features-1.11>` for more
  218. details on these changes.
  219. * ``contrib.auth.views.login()``, ``logout()``, ``password_change()``,
  220. ``password_change_done()``, ``password_reset()``, ``password_reset_done()``,
  221. ``password_reset_confirm()``, and ``password_reset_complete()`` will be
  222. removed.
  223. * The ``extra_context`` parameter of ``contrib.auth.views.logout_then_login()``
  224. will be removed.
  225. * ``django.test.runner.setup_databases()`` will be removed.
  226. * ``django.utils.translation.string_concat()`` will be removed.
  227. * ``django.core.cache.backends.memcached.PyLibMCCache`` will no longer support
  228. passing ``pylibmc`` behavior settings as top-level attributes of ``OPTIONS``.
  229. * The ``host`` parameter of ``django.utils.http.is_safe_url()`` will be
  230. removed.
  231. * Silencing of exceptions raised while rendering the ``{% include %}`` template
  232. tag will be removed.
  233. * ``DatabaseIntrospection.get_indexes()`` will be removed.
  234. * The ``authenticate()`` method of authentication backends will require
  235. ``request`` as the first positional argument.
  236. * The ``django.db.models.permalink()`` decorator will be removed.
  237. * The ``USE_ETAGS`` setting will be removed. ``CommonMiddleware`` and
  238. ``django.utils.cache.patch_response_headers()`` will no longer set ETags.
  239. * The ``Model._meta.has_auto_field`` attribute will be removed.
  240. * ``url()``'s support for inline flags in regular expression groups (``(?i)``,
  241. ``(?L)``, ``(?m)``, ``(?s)``, and ``(?u)``) will be removed.
  242. * Support for ``Widget.render()`` methods without the ``renderer`` argument
  243. will be removed.
  244. .. _deprecation-removed-in-2.0:
  245. 2.0
  246. ---
  247. See the :ref:`Django 1.9 release notes<deprecated-features-1.9>` for more
  248. details on these changes.
  249. * The ``weak`` argument to ``django.dispatch.signals.Signal.disconnect()`` will
  250. be removed.
  251. * ``django.db.backends.base.BaseDatabaseOperations.check_aggregate_support()``
  252. will be removed.
  253. * The ``django.forms.extras`` package will be removed.
  254. * The ``assignment_tag`` helper will be removed.
  255. * The ``host`` argument to ``assertsRedirects`` will be removed. The
  256. compatibility layer which allows absolute URLs to be considered equal to
  257. relative ones when the path is identical will also be removed.
  258. * ``Field.rel`` will be removed.
  259. * ``Field.remote_field.to`` attribute will be removed.
  260. * The ``on_delete`` argument for ``ForeignKey`` and ``OneToOneField`` will be
  261. required.
  262. * ``django.db.models.fields.add_lazy_relation()`` will be removed.
  263. * When time zone support is enabled, database backends that don't support time
  264. zones won't convert aware datetimes to naive values in UTC anymore when such
  265. values are passed as parameters to SQL queries executed outside of the ORM,
  266. e.g. with ``cursor.execute()``.
  267. * The ``django.contrib.auth.tests.utils.skipIfCustomUser()`` decorator will be
  268. removed.
  269. * The ``GeoManager`` and ``GeoQuerySet`` classes will be removed.
  270. * The ``django.contrib.gis.geoip`` module will be removed.
  271. * The ``supports_recursion`` check for template loaders will be removed from:
  272. * ``django.template.engine.Engine.find_template()``
  273. * ``django.template.loader_tags.ExtendsNode.find_template()``
  274. * ``django.template.loaders.base.Loader.supports_recursion()``
  275. * ``django.template.loaders.cached.Loader.supports_recursion()``
  276. * The ``load_template()`` and ``load_template_sources()`` template loader
  277. methods will be removed.
  278. * The ``template_dirs`` argument for template loaders will be removed:
  279. * ``django.template.loaders.base.Loader.get_template()``
  280. * ``django.template.loaders.cached.Loader.cache_key()``
  281. * ``django.template.loaders.cached.Loader.get_template()``
  282. * ``django.template.loaders.cached.Loader.get_template_sources()``
  283. * ``django.template.loaders.filesystem.Loader.get_template_sources()``
  284. * The ``django.template.loaders.base.Loader.__call__()`` method will be
  285. removed.
  286. * Support for custom error views with a single positional parameter will be
  287. dropped.
  288. * The ``mime_type`` attribute of ``django.utils.feedgenerator.Atom1Feed`` and
  289. ``django.utils.feedgenerator.RssFeed`` will be removed in favor of
  290. ``content_type``.
  291. * The ``app_name`` argument to ``django.conf.urls.include()`` will be
  292. removed.
  293. * Support for passing a 3-tuple as the first argument to ``include()`` will
  294. be removed.
  295. * Support for setting a URL instance namespace without an application
  296. namespace will be removed.
  297. * ``Field._get_val_from_obj()`` will be removed in favor of
  298. ``Field.value_from_object()``.
  299. * ``django.template.loaders.eggs.Loader`` will be removed.
  300. * The ``current_app`` parameter to the ``contrib.auth`` views will be removed.
  301. * The ``callable_obj`` keyword argument to
  302. ``SimpleTestCase.assertRaisesMessage()`` will be removed.
  303. * Support for the ``allow_tags`` attribute on ``ModelAdmin`` methods will be
  304. removed.
  305. * The ``enclosure`` keyword argument to ``SyndicationFeed.add_item()`` will be
  306. removed.
  307. * The ``django.template.loader.LoaderOrigin`` and
  308. ``django.template.base.StringOrigin`` aliases for
  309. ``django.template.base.Origin`` will be removed.
  310. See the :ref:`Django 1.10 release notes <deprecated-features-1.10>` for more
  311. details on these changes.
  312. * The ``makemigrations --exit`` option will be removed.
  313. * Support for direct assignment to a reverse foreign key or many-to-many
  314. relation will be removed.
  315. * The ``get_srid()`` and ``set_srid()`` methods of
  316. ``django.contrib.gis.geos.GEOSGeometry`` will be removed.
  317. * The ``get_x()``, ``set_x()``, ``get_y()``, ``set_y()``, ``get_z()``, and
  318. ``set_z()`` methods of ``django.contrib.gis.geos.Point`` will be removed.
  319. * The ``get_coords()`` and ``set_coords()`` methods of
  320. ``django.contrib.gis.geos.Point`` will be removed.
  321. * The ``cascaded_union`` property of ``django.contrib.gis.geos.MultiPolygon``
  322. will be removed.
  323. * ``django.utils.functional.allow_lazy()`` will be removed.
  324. * The ``shell --plain`` option will be removed.
  325. * The ``django.core.urlresolvers`` module will be removed.
  326. * The model ``CommaSeparatedIntegerField`` will be removed. A stub field will
  327. remain for compatibility with historical migrations.
  328. * Support for the template ``Context.has_key()`` method will be removed.
  329. * Support for the ``django.core.files.storage.Storage.accessed_time()``,
  330. ``created_time()``, and ``modified_time()`` methods will be removed.
  331. * Support for query lookups using the model name when
  332. ``Meta.default_related_name`` is set will be removed.
  333. * The ``__search`` query lookup and the
  334. ``DatabaseOperations.fulltext_search_sql()`` method will be removed.
  335. * The shim for supporting custom related manager classes without a
  336. ``_apply_rel_filters()`` method will be removed.
  337. * Using ``User.is_authenticated()`` and ``User.is_anonymous()`` as methods
  338. will no longer be supported.
  339. * The private attribute ``virtual_fields`` of ``Model._meta`` will be removed.
  340. * The private keyword arguments ``virtual_only`` in
  341. ``Field.contribute_to_class()`` and ``virtual`` in
  342. ``Model._meta.add_field()`` will be removed.
  343. * The ``javascript_catalog()`` and ``json_catalog()`` views will be removed.
  344. * The ``django.contrib.gis.utils.precision_wkt()`` function will be removed.
  345. * In multi-table inheritance, implicit promotion of a ``OneToOneField`` to a
  346. ``parent_link`` will be removed.
  347. * Support for ``Widget._format_value()`` will be removed.
  348. * ``FileField`` methods ``get_directory_name()`` and ``get_filename()`` will be
  349. removed.
  350. * The ``mark_for_escaping()`` function and the classes it uses: ``EscapeData``,
  351. ``EscapeBytes``, ``EscapeText``, ``EscapeString``, and ``EscapeUnicode`` will
  352. be removed.
  353. * The ``escape`` filter will change to use
  354. ``django.utils.html.conditional_escape()``.
  355. * ``Manager.use_for_related_fields`` will be removed.
  356. * Model ``Manager`` inheritance will follow MRO inheritance rules and the
  357. ``Meta.manager_inheritance_from_future`` to opt-in to this behavior will be
  358. removed.
  359. * Support for old-style middleware using ``settings.MIDDLEWARE_CLASSES`` will
  360. be removed.
  361.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.10:
  362. 1.10
  363. ----
  364. See the :ref:`Django 1.8 release notes<deprecated-features-1.8>` for more
  365. details on these changes.
  366. * Support for calling a ``SQLCompiler`` directly as an alias for calling its
  367. ``quote_name_unless_alias`` method will be removed.
  368. * ``cycle`` and ``firstof`` template tags will be removed from the ``future``
  369. template tag library (used during the 1.6/1.7 deprecation period).
  370. * ``django.conf.urls.patterns()`` will be removed.
  371. * Support for the ``prefix`` argument to
  372. ``django.conf.urls.i18n.i18n_patterns()`` will be removed.
  373. * ``SimpleTestCase.urls`` will be removed.
  374. * Using an incorrect count of unpacked values in the ``for`` template tag
  375. will raise an exception rather than fail silently.
  376. * The ability to reverse URLs using a dotted Python path will be removed.
  377. * The ability to use a dotted Python path for the ``LOGIN_URL`` and
  378. ``LOGIN_REDIRECT_URL`` settings will be removed.
  379. * Support for :py:mod:`optparse` will be dropped for custom management commands
  380. (replaced by :py:mod:`argparse`).
  381. * The class ``django.core.management.NoArgsCommand`` will be removed. Use
  382. :class:`~django.core.management.BaseCommand` instead, which takes no arguments
  383. by default.
  384. * ``django.core.context_processors`` module will be removed.
  385. * ``django.db.models.sql.aggregates`` module will be removed.
  386. * ``django.contrib.gis.db.models.sql.aggregates`` module will be removed.
  387. * The following methods and properties of ``django.db.sql.query.Query`` will
  388. be removed:
  389. * Properties: ``aggregates`` and ``aggregate_select``
  390. * Methods: ``add_aggregate``, ``set_aggregate_mask``, and
  391. ``append_aggregate_mask``.
  392. * ``django.template.resolve_variable`` will be removed.
  393. * The following private APIs will be removed from
  394. :class:`django.db.models.options.Options` (``Model._meta``):
  395. * ``get_field_by_name()``
  396. * ``get_all_field_names()``
  397. * ``get_fields_with_model()``
  398. * ``get_concrete_fields_with_model()``
  399. * ``get_m2m_with_model()``
  400. * ``get_all_related_objects()``
  401. * ``get_all_related_objects_with_model()``
  402. * ``get_all_related_many_to_many_objects()``
  403. * ``get_all_related_m2m_objects_with_model()``
  404. * The ``error_message`` argument of ``django.forms.RegexField`` will be removed.
  405. * The ``unordered_list`` filter will no longer support old style lists.
  406. * Support for string ``view`` arguments to ``url()`` will be removed.
  407. * The backward compatible shim to rename ``django.forms.Form._has_changed()``
  408. to ``has_changed()`` will be removed.
  409. * The ``removetags`` template filter will be removed.
  410. * The ``remove_tags()`` and ``strip_entities()`` functions in
  411. ``django.utils.html`` will be removed.
  412. * The ``is_admin_site`` argument to
  413. ``django.contrib.auth.views.password_reset()`` will be removed.
  414. * ``django.db.models.field.subclassing.SubfieldBase`` will be removed.
  415. * ``django.utils.checksums`` will be removed; its functionality is included
  416. in ``django-localflavor`` 1.1+.
  417. * The ``original_content_type_id`` attribute on
  418. ``django.contrib.admin.helpers.InlineAdminForm`` will be removed.
  419. * The backwards compatibility shim to allow ``FormMixin.get_form()`` to be
  420. defined with no default value for its ``form_class`` argument will be removed.
  421. * The following settings will be removed:
  422. * ``ALLOWED_INCLUDE_ROOTS``
  423. * ``TEMPLATE_CONTEXT_PROCESSORS``
  424. * ``TEMPLATE_DEBUG``
  425. * ``TEMPLATE_DIRS``
  426. * ``TEMPLATE_LOADERS``
  427. * ``TEMPLATE_STRING_IF_INVALID``
  428. * The backwards compatibility alias ``django.template.loader.BaseLoader`` will
  429. be removed.
  430. * Django template objects returned by
  431. :func:`~django.template.loader.get_template` and
  432. :func:`~django.template.loader.select_template` won't accept a
  433. :class:`~django.template.Context` in their
  434. :meth:`~django.template.backends.base.Template.render()` method anymore.
  435. * :doc:`Template response APIs </ref/template-response>` will enforce the use
  436. of :class:`dict` and backend-dependent template objects instead of
  437. :class:`~django.template.Context` and :class:`~django.template.Template`
  438. respectively.
  439. * The ``current_app`` parameter for the following function and classes will be
  440. removed:
  441. * ``django.shortcuts.render()``
  442. * ``django.template.Context()``
  443. * ``django.template.RequestContext()``
  444. * ``django.template.response.TemplateResponse()``
  445. * The ``dictionary`` and ``context_instance`` parameters for the following
  446. functions will be removed:
  447. * ``django.shortcuts.render()``
  448. * ``django.shortcuts.render_to_response()``
  449. * ``django.template.loader.render_to_string()``
  450. * The ``dirs`` parameter for the following functions will be removed:
  451. * ``django.template.loader.get_template()``
  452. * ``django.template.loader.select_template()``
  453. * ``django.shortcuts.render()``
  454. * ``django.shortcuts.render_to_response()``
  455. * Session verification will be enabled regardless of whether or not
  456. ``'django.contrib.auth.middleware.SessionAuthenticationMiddleware'`` is in
  457. ``MIDDLEWARE_CLASSES``.
  458. * Private attribute ``django.db.models.Field.related`` will be removed.
  459. * The ``--list`` option of the ``migrate`` management command will be removed.
  460. * The ``ssi`` template tag will be removed.
  461. * Support for the ``=`` comparison operator in the ``if`` template tag will be
  462. removed.
  463. * The backwards compatibility shims to allow ``Storage.get_available_name()``
  464. and ``Storage.save()`` to be defined without a ``max_length`` argument will
  465. be removed.
  466. * Support for the legacy ``%(<foo>)s`` syntax in ``ModelFormMixin.success_url``
  467. will be removed.
  468. * ``GeoQuerySet`` aggregate methods ``collect()``, ``extent()``, ``extent3d()``,
  469. ``make_line()``, and ``unionagg()`` will be removed.
  470. * Ability to specify ``ContentType.name`` when creating a content type instance
  471. will be removed.
  472. * Support for the old signature of ``allow_migrate`` will be removed. It changed
  473. from ``allow_migrate(self, db, model)`` to
  474. ``allow_migrate(self, db, app_label, model_name=None, **hints)``.
  475. * Support for the syntax of ``{% cycle %}`` that uses comma-separated arguments
  476. will be removed.
  477. * The warning that :class:`~django.core.signing.Signer` issues when given an
  478. invalid separator will become an exception.
  479.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.9:
  480. 1.9
  481. ---
  482. See the :ref:`Django 1.7 release notes<deprecated-features-1.7>` for more
  483. details on these changes.
  484. * ``django.utils.dictconfig`` will be removed.
  485. * ``django.utils.importlib`` will be removed.
  486. * ``django.utils.tzinfo`` will be removed.
  487. * ``django.utils.unittest`` will be removed.
  488. * The ``syncdb`` command will be removed.
  489. * ``django.db.models.signals.pre_syncdb`` and
  490. ``django.db.models.signals.post_syncdb`` will be removed.
  491. * ``allow_syncdb`` on database routers will no longer automatically become
  492. ``allow_migrate``.
  493. * Automatic syncing of apps without migrations will be removed. Migrations will
  494. become compulsory for all apps unless you pass the ``--run-syncdb`` option to
  495. ``migrate``.
  496. * The SQL management commands for apps without migrations, ``sql``, ``sqlall``,
  497. ``sqlclear``, ``sqldropindexes``, and ``sqlindexes``, will be removed.
  498. * Support for automatic loading of ``initial_data`` fixtures and initial SQL
  499. data will be removed.
  500. * All models will need to be defined inside an installed application or
  501. declare an explicit :attr:`~django.db.models.Options.app_label`.
  502. Furthermore, it won't be possible to import them before their application
  503. is loaded. In particular, it won't be possible to import models inside
  504. the root package of their application.
  505. * The model and form ``IPAddressField`` will be removed. A stub field will
  506. remain for compatibility with historical migrations.
  507. * ``AppCommand.handle_app()`` will no longer be supported.
  508. * ``RequestSite`` and ``get_current_site()`` will no longer be importable from
  509. ``django.contrib.sites.models``.
  510. * FastCGI support via the ``runfcgi`` management command will be
  511. removed. Please deploy your project using WSGI.
  512. * ``django.utils.datastructures.SortedDict`` will be removed. Use
  513. :class:`collections.OrderedDict` from the Python standard library instead.
  514. * ``ModelAdmin.declared_fieldsets`` will be removed.
  515. * Instances of ``util.py`` in the Django codebase have been renamed to
  516. ``utils.py`` in an effort to unify all util and utils references.
  517. The modules that provided backwards compatibility will be removed:
  518. * ``django.contrib.admin.util``
  519. * ``django.contrib.gis.db.backends.util``
  520. * ``django.db.backends.util``
  521. * ``django.forms.util``
  522. * ``ModelAdmin.get_formsets`` will be removed.
  523. * The backward compatibility shim introduced to rename the
  524. ``BaseMemcachedCache._get_memcache_timeout()`` method to
  525. ``get_backend_timeout()`` will be removed.
  526. * The ``--natural`` and ``-n`` options for :djadmin:`dumpdata` will be removed.
  527. * The ``use_natural_keys`` argument for ``serializers.serialize()`` will be
  528. removed.
  529. * Private API ``django.forms.forms.get_declared_fields()`` will be removed.
  530. * The ability to use a ``SplitDateTimeWidget`` with ``DateTimeField`` will be
  531. removed.
  532. * The ``WSGIRequest.REQUEST`` property will be removed.
  533. * The class ``django.utils.datastructures.MergeDict`` will be removed.
  534. * The ``zh-cn`` and ``zh-tw`` language codes will be removed and have been
  535. replaced by the ``zh-hans`` and ``zh-hant`` language code respectively.
  536. * The internal ``django.utils.functional.memoize`` will be removed.
  537. * ``django.core.cache.get_cache`` will be removed. Add suitable entries
  538. to :setting:`CACHES` and use :data:`django.core.cache.caches` instead.
  539. * ``django.db.models.loading`` will be removed.
  540. * Passing callable arguments to querysets will no longer be possible.
  541. * ``BaseCommand.requires_model_validation`` will be removed in favor of
  542. ``requires_system_checks``. Admin validators will be replaced by admin
  543. checks.
  544. * The ``ModelAdmin.validator_class`` and ``default_validator_class`` attributes
  545. will be removed.
  546. * ``ModelAdmin.validate()`` will be removed.
  547. * ``django.db.backends.DatabaseValidation.validate_field`` will be removed in
  548. favor of the ``check_field`` method.
  549. * The ``validate`` management command will be removed.
  550. * ``django.utils.module_loading.import_by_path`` will be removed in favor of
  551. ``django.utils.module_loading.import_string``.
  552. * ``ssi`` and ``url`` template tags will be removed from the ``future`` template
  553. tag library (used during the 1.3/1.4 deprecation period).
  554. * ``django.utils.text.javascript_quote`` will be removed.
  555. * Database test settings as independent entries in the database settings,
  556. prefixed by ``TEST_``, will no longer be supported.
  557. * The ``cache_choices`` option to :class:`~django.forms.ModelChoiceField` and
  558. :class:`~django.forms.ModelMultipleChoiceField` will be removed.
  559. * The default value of the
  560. :attr:`RedirectView.permanent <django.views.generic.base.RedirectView.permanent>`
  561. attribute will change from ``True`` to ``False``.
  562. * ``django.contrib.sitemaps.FlatPageSitemap`` will be removed in favor of
  563. ``django.contrib.flatpages.sitemaps.FlatPageSitemap``.
  564. * Private API ``django.test.utils.TestTemplateLoader`` will be removed.
  565. * The ``django.contrib.contenttypes.generic`` module will be removed.
  566. * Private APIs ``django.db.models.sql.where.WhereNode.make_atom()`` and
  567. ``django.db.models.sql.where.Constraint`` will be removed.
  568.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.8:
  569. 1.8
  570. ---
  571. See the :ref:`Django 1.6 release notes<deprecated-features-1.6>` for more
  572. details on these changes.
  573. * ``django.contrib.comments`` will be removed.
  574. * The following transaction management APIs will be removed:
  575. - ``TransactionMiddleware``,
  576. - the decorators and context managers ``autocommit``, ``commit_on_success``,
  577. and ``commit_manually``, defined in ``django.db.transaction``,
  578. - the functions ``commit_unless_managed`` and ``rollback_unless_managed``,
  579. also defined in ``django.db.transaction``,
  580. - the ``TRANSACTIONS_MANAGED`` setting.
  581. * The :ttag:`cycle` and :ttag:`firstof` template tags will auto-escape their
  582. arguments. In 1.6 and 1.7, this behavior is provided by the version of these
  583. tags in the ``future`` template tag library.
  584. * The ``SEND_BROKEN_LINK_EMAILS`` setting will be removed. Add the
  585. :class:`django.middleware.common.BrokenLinkEmailsMiddleware` middleware to
  586. your ``MIDDLEWARE_CLASSES`` setting instead.
  587. * ``django.middleware.doc.XViewMiddleware`` will be removed. Use
  588. ``django.contrib.admindocs.middleware.XViewMiddleware`` instead.
  589. * ``Model._meta.module_name`` was renamed to ``model_name``.
  590. * Remove the backward compatible shims introduced to rename ``get_query_set``
  591. and similar queryset methods. This affects the following classes:
  592. ``BaseModelAdmin``, ``ChangeList``, ``BaseCommentNode``,
  593. ``GenericForeignKey``, ``Manager``, ``SingleRelatedObjectDescriptor`` and
  594. ``ReverseSingleRelatedObjectDescriptor``.
  595. * Remove the backward compatible shims introduced to rename the attributes
  596. ``ChangeList.root_query_set`` and ``ChangeList.query_set``.
  597. * ``django.views.defaults.shortcut`` will be removed, as part of the
  598. goal of removing all ``django.contrib`` references from the core
  599. Django codebase. Instead use
  600. ``django.contrib.contenttypes.views.shortcut``. ``django.conf.urls.shortcut``
  601. will also be removed.
  602. * Support for the Python Imaging Library (PIL) module will be removed, as it
  603. no longer appears to be actively maintained & does not work on Python 3.
  604. * The following private APIs will be removed:
  605. - ``django.db.backend``
  606. - ``django.db.close_connection()``
  607. - ``django.db.backends.creation.BaseDatabaseCreation.set_autocommit()``
  608. - ``django.db.transaction.is_managed()``
  609. - ``django.db.transaction.managed()``
  610. * ``django.forms.widgets.RadioInput`` will be removed in favor of
  611. ``django.forms.widgets.RadioChoiceInput``.
  612. * The module ``django.test.simple`` and the class
  613. ``django.test.simple.DjangoTestSuiteRunner`` will be removed. Instead use
  614. ``django.test.runner.DiscoverRunner``.
  615. * The module ``django.test._doctest`` will be removed. Instead use the doctest
  616. module from the Python standard library.
  617. * The ``CACHE_MIDDLEWARE_ANONYMOUS_ONLY`` setting will be removed.
  618. * Usage of the hard-coded *Hold down "Control", or "Command" on a Mac, to select
  619. more than one.* string to override or append to user-provided ``help_text`` in
  620. forms for ManyToMany model fields will not be performed by Django anymore
  621. either at the model or forms layer.
  622. * The ``Model._meta.get_(add|change|delete)_permission`` methods will
  623. be removed.
  624. * The session key ``django_language`` will no longer be read for backwards
  625. compatibility.
  626. * Geographic Sitemaps will be removed
  627. (``django.contrib.gis.sitemaps.views.index`` and
  628. ``django.contrib.gis.sitemaps.views.sitemap``).
  629. * ``django.utils.html.fix_ampersands``, the ``fix_ampersands`` template filter and
  630. ``django.utils.html.clean_html`` will be removed following an accelerated deprecation.
  631.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.7:
  632. 1.7
  633. ---
  634. See the :ref:`Django 1.5 release notes<deprecated-features-1.5>` for more
  635. details on these changes.
  636. * The module ``django.utils.simplejson`` will be removed. The standard library
  637. provides :mod:`json` which should be used instead.
  638. * The function ``django.utils.itercompat.product`` will be removed. The Python
  639. builtin version should be used instead.
  640. * Auto-correction of INSTALLED_APPS and TEMPLATE_DIRS settings when they are
  641. specified as a plain string instead of a tuple will be removed and raise an
  642. exception.
  643. * The ``mimetype`` argument to the ``__init__`` methods of
  644. :class:`~django.http.HttpResponse`,
  645. :class:`~django.template.response.SimpleTemplateResponse`, and
  646. :class:`~django.template.response.TemplateResponse`, will be removed.
  647. ``content_type`` should be used instead. This also applies to the
  648. ``render_to_response()`` shortcut and the sitemap views,
  649. :func:`~django.contrib.sitemaps.views.index` and
  650. :func:`~django.contrib.sitemaps.views.sitemap`.
  651. * When :class:`~django.http.HttpResponse` is instantiated with an iterator,
  652. or when :attr:`~django.http.HttpResponse.content` is set to an iterator,
  653. that iterator will be immediately consumed.
  654. * The ``AUTH_PROFILE_MODULE`` setting, and the ``get_profile()`` method on
  655. the User model, will be removed.
  656. * The ``cleanup`` management command will be removed. It's replaced by
  657. ``clearsessions``.
  658. * The ``daily_cleanup.py`` script will be removed.
  659. * The ``depth`` keyword argument will be removed from
  660. :meth:`~django.db.models.query.QuerySet.select_related`.
  661. * The undocumented ``get_warnings_state()``/``restore_warnings_state()``
  662. functions from :mod:`django.test.utils` and the ``save_warnings_state()``/
  663. ``restore_warnings_state()``
  664. :ref:`django.test.*TestCase <django-testcase-subclasses>` methods are
  665. deprecated. Use the :class:`warnings.catch_warnings` context manager
  666. available starting with Python 2.6 instead.
  667. * The undocumented ``check_for_test_cookie`` method in
  668. :class:`~django.contrib.auth.forms.AuthenticationForm` will be removed
  669. following an accelerated deprecation. Users subclassing this form should
  670. remove calls to this method, and instead ensure that their auth related views
  671. are CSRF protected, which ensures that cookies are enabled.
  672. * The version of ``django.contrib.auth.views.password_reset_confirm()`` that
  673. supports base36 encoded user IDs
  674. (``django.contrib.auth.views.password_reset_confirm_uidb36``) will be
  675. removed. If your site has been running Django 1.6 for more than
  676. ``PASSWORD_RESET_TIMEOUT_DAYS``, this change will have no effect. If not,
  677. then any password reset links generated before you upgrade to Django 1.7
  678. won't work after the upgrade.
  679. * The ``django.utils.encoding.StrAndUnicode`` mix-in will be removed.
  680.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.6:
  681. 1.6
  682. ---
  683. See the :ref:`Django 1.4 release notes<deprecated-features-1.4>` for more
  684. details on these changes.
  685. * ``django.contrib.databrowse`` will be removed.
  686. * ``django.contrib.localflavor`` will be removed following an accelerated
  687. deprecation.
  688. * ``django.contrib.markup`` will be removed following an accelerated
  689. deprecation.
  690. * The compatibility modules ``django.utils.copycompat`` and
  691. ``django.utils.hashcompat`` as well as the functions
  692. ``django.utils.itercompat.all`` and ``django.utils.itercompat.any`` will
  693. be removed. The Python builtin versions should be used instead.
  694. * The ``csrf_response_exempt`` and ``csrf_view_exempt`` decorators will
  695. be removed. Since 1.4 ``csrf_response_exempt`` has been a no-op (it
  696. returns the same function), and ``csrf_view_exempt`` has been a
  697. synonym for ``django.views.decorators.csrf.csrf_exempt``, which should
  698. be used to replace it.
  699. * The ``django.core.cache.backends.memcached.CacheClass`` backend
  700. was split into two in Django 1.3 in order to introduce support for
  701. PyLibMC. The historical ``CacheClass`` will be removed in favor of
  702. ``django.core.cache.backends.memcached.MemcachedCache``.
  703. * The UK-prefixed objects of ``django.contrib.localflavor.uk`` will only
  704. be accessible through their GB-prefixed names (GB is the correct
  705. ISO 3166 code for United Kingdom).
  706. * The ``IGNORABLE_404_STARTS`` and ``IGNORABLE_404_ENDS`` settings have been
  707. superseded by :setting:`IGNORABLE_404_URLS` in the 1.4 release. They will be
  708. removed.
  709. * The form wizard has been refactored to use class-based views with pluggable
  710. backends in 1.4. The previous implementation will be removed.
  711. * Legacy ways of calling
  712. :func:`~django.views.decorators.cache.cache_page` will be removed.
  713. * The backward-compatibility shim to automatically add a debug-false
  714. filter to the ``'mail_admins'`` logging handler will be removed. The
  715. :setting:`LOGGING` setting should include this filter explicitly if
  716. it is desired.
  717. * The builtin truncation functions ``django.utils.text.truncate_words()``
  718. and ``django.utils.text.truncate_html_words()`` will be removed in
  719. favor of the ``django.utils.text.Truncator`` class.
  720. * The ``django.contrib.gis.geoip.GeoIP`` class was moved to
  721. ``django.contrib.gis.geoip`` in 1.4 -- the shortcut in
  722. ``django.contrib.gis.utils`` will be removed.
  723. * ``django.conf.urls.defaults`` will be removed. The functions
  724. ``include()``, ``patterns()``, and ``url()``, plus
  725. :data:`~django.conf.urls.handler404` and :data:`~django.conf.urls.handler500`
  726. are now available through ``django.conf.urls``.
  727. * The functions ``setup_environ()`` and ``execute_manager()`` will be removed
  728. from :mod:`django.core.management`. This also means that the old (pre-1.4)
  729. style of :file:`manage.py` file will no longer work.
  730. * Setting the ``is_safe`` and ``needs_autoescape`` flags as attributes of
  731. template filter functions will no longer be supported.
  732. * The attribute ``HttpRequest.raw_post_data`` was renamed to ``HttpRequest.body``
  733. in 1.4. The backward compatibility will be removed --
  734. ``HttpRequest.raw_post_data`` will no longer work.
  735. * The value for the ``post_url_continue`` parameter in
  736. ``ModelAdmin.response_add()`` will have to be either ``None`` (to redirect
  737. to the newly created object's edit page) or a pre-formatted url. String
  738. formats, such as the previous default ``'../%s/'``, will not be accepted any
  739. more.
  740.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.5:
  741. 1.5
  742. ---
  743. See the :ref:`Django 1.3 release notes<deprecated-features-1.3>` for more
  744. details on these changes.
  745. * Starting Django without a :setting:`SECRET_KEY` will result in an exception
  746. rather than a ``DeprecationWarning``. (This is accelerated from the usual
  747. deprecation path; see the :doc:`Django 1.4 release notes</releases/1.4>`.)
  748. * The ``mod_python`` request handler will be removed. The ``mod_wsgi``
  749. handler should be used instead.
  750. * The ``template`` attribute on ``django.test.client.Response``
  751. objects returned by the :ref:`test client <test-client>` will be removed.
  752. The :attr:`~django.test.Response.templates` attribute should be
  753. used instead.
  754. * The ``django.test.simple.DjangoTestRunner`` will be removed.
  755. Instead use a ``unittest``-native class. The features of the
  756. ``django.test.simple.DjangoTestRunner`` (including fail-fast and
  757. Ctrl-C test termination) can be provided by :class:`unittest.TextTestRunner`.
  758. * The undocumented function
  759. ``django.contrib.formtools.utils.security_hash`` will be removed,
  760. instead use ``django.contrib.formtools.utils.form_hmac``
  761. * The function-based generic view modules will be removed in favor of their
  762. class-based equivalents, outlined :doc:`here
  763. </topics/class-based-views/index>`.
  764. * The ``django.core.servers.basehttp.AdminMediaHandler`` will be
  765. removed. In its place use
  766. ``django.contrib.staticfiles.handlers.StaticFilesHandler``.
  767. * The template tags library ``adminmedia`` and the template tag ``{%
  768. admin_media_prefix %}`` will be removed in favor of the generic static files
  769. handling. (This is faster than the usual deprecation path; see the
  770. :doc:`Django 1.4 release notes</releases/1.4>`.)
  771. * The ``url`` and ``ssi`` template tags will be modified so that the first
  772. argument to each tag is a template variable, not an implied string. In 1.4,
  773. this behavior is provided by a version of the tag in the ``future`` template
  774. tag library.
  775. * The ``reset`` and ``sqlreset`` management commands will be removed.
  776. * Authentication backends will need to support an inactive user
  777. being passed to all methods dealing with permissions.
  778. The ``supports_inactive_user`` attribute will no longer be checked
  779. and can be removed from custom backends.
  780. * :meth:`~django.contrib.gis.geos.GEOSGeometry.transform` will raise
  781. a :class:`~django.contrib.gis.geos.GEOSException` when called
  782. on a geometry with no SRID value.
  783. * ``django.http.CompatCookie`` will be removed in favor of
  784. ``django.http.SimpleCookie``.
  785. * ``django.core.context_processors.PermWrapper`` and
  786. ``django.core.context_processors.PermLookupDict`` will be removed in
  787. favor of the corresponding
  788. ``django.contrib.auth.context_processors.PermWrapper`` and
  789. ``django.contrib.auth.context_processors.PermLookupDict``, respectively.
  790. * The :setting:`MEDIA_URL` or :setting:`STATIC_URL` settings will be
  791. required to end with a trailing slash to ensure there is a consistent
  792. way to combine paths in templates.
  793. * ``django.db.models.fields.URLField.verify_exists`` will be removed. The
  794. feature was deprecated in 1.3.1 due to intractable security and
  795. performance issues and will follow a slightly accelerated deprecation
  796. timeframe.
  797. * Translations located under the so-called *project path* will be ignored during
  798. the translation building process performed at runtime. The
  799. :setting:`LOCALE_PATHS` setting can be used for the same task by including the
  800. filesystem path to a ``locale`` directory containing non-app-specific
  801. translations in its value.
  802. * The Markup contrib app will no longer support versions of Python-Markdown
  803. library earlier than 2.1. An accelerated timeline was used as this was
  804. a security related deprecation.
  805. * The ``CACHE_BACKEND`` setting will be removed. The cache backend(s) should be
  806. specified in the :setting:`CACHES` setting.
  807.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.4:
  808. 1.4
  809. ---
  810. See the :ref:`Django 1.2 release notes<deprecated-features-1.2>` for more
  811. details on these changes.
  812. * ``CsrfResponseMiddleware`` and ``CsrfMiddleware`` will be removed. Use
  813. the ``{% csrf_token %}`` template tag inside forms to enable CSRF
  814. protection. ``CsrfViewMiddleware`` remains and is enabled by default.
  815. * The old imports for CSRF functionality (``django.contrib.csrf.*``),
  816. which moved to core in 1.2, will be removed.
  817. * The ``django.contrib.gis.db.backend`` module will be removed in favor
  818. of the specific backends.
  819. * ``SMTPConnection`` will be removed in favor of a generic email backend API.
  820. * The many to many SQL generation functions on the database backends
  821. will be removed.
  822. * The ability to use the ``DATABASE_*`` family of top-level settings to
  823. define database connections will be removed.
  824. * The ability to use shorthand notation to specify a database backend
  825. (i.e., ``sqlite3`` instead of ``django.db.backends.sqlite3``) will be
  826. removed.
  827. * The ``get_db_prep_save``, ``get_db_prep_value`` and
  828. ``get_db_prep_lookup`` methods will have to support multiple databases.
  829. * The ``Message`` model (in ``django.contrib.auth``), its related
  830. manager in the ``User`` model (``user.message_set``), and the
  831. associated methods (``user.message_set.create()`` and
  832. ``user.get_and_delete_messages()``), will be removed. The
  833. :doc:`messages framework </ref/contrib/messages>` should be used
  834. instead. The related ``messages`` variable returned by the
  835. auth context processor will also be removed. Note that this
  836. means that the admin application will depend on the messages
  837. context processor.
  838. * Authentication backends will need to support the ``obj`` parameter for
  839. permission checking. The ``supports_object_permissions`` attribute
  840. will no longer be checked and can be removed from custom backends.
  841. * Authentication backends will need to support the ``AnonymousUser`` class
  842. being passed to all methods dealing with permissions. The
  843. ``supports_anonymous_user`` variable will no longer be checked and can be
  844. removed from custom backends.
  845. * The ability to specify a callable template loader rather than a
  846. ``Loader`` class will be removed, as will the ``load_template_source``
  847. functions that are included with the built in template loaders for
  848. backwards compatibility.
  849. * ``django.utils.translation.get_date_formats()`` and
  850. ``django.utils.translation.get_partial_date_formats()``. These functions
  851. will be removed; use the locale-aware
  852. ``django.utils.formats.get_format()`` to get the appropriate formats.
  853. * In ``django.forms.fields``, the constants: ``DEFAULT_DATE_INPUT_FORMATS``,
  854. ``DEFAULT_TIME_INPUT_FORMATS`` and
  855. ``DEFAULT_DATETIME_INPUT_FORMATS`` will be removed. Use
  856. ``django.utils.formats.get_format()`` to get the appropriate
  857. formats.
  858. * The ability to use a function-based test runner will be removed,
  859. along with the ``django.test.simple.run_tests()`` test runner.
  860. * The ``views.feed()`` view and ``feeds.Feed`` class in
  861. ``django.contrib.syndication`` will be removed. The class-based view
  862. ``views.Feed`` should be used instead.
  863. * ``django.core.context_processors.auth``. This release will
  864. remove the old method in favor of the new method in
  865. ``django.contrib.auth.context_processors.auth``.
  866. * The ``postgresql`` database backend will be removed, use the
  867. ``postgresql_psycopg2`` backend instead.
  868. * The ``no`` language code will be removed and has been replaced by the
  869. ``nb`` language code.
  870. * Authentication backends will need to define the boolean attribute
  871. ``supports_inactive_user`` until version 1.5 when it will be assumed that
  872. all backends will handle inactive users.
  873. * ``django.db.models.fields.XMLField`` will be removed. This was
  874. deprecated as part of the 1.3 release. An accelerated deprecation
  875. schedule has been used because the field hasn't performed any role
  876. beyond that of a simple ``TextField`` since the removal of ``oldforms``.
  877. All uses of ``XMLField`` can be replaced with ``TextField``.
  878. * The undocumented ``mixin`` parameter to the ``open()`` method of
  879. ``django.core.files.storage.Storage`` (and subclasses) will be removed.
  880. .. _deprecation-removed-in-1.3:
  881. 1.3
  882. ---
  883. See the :ref:`Django 1.1 release notes<deprecated-features-1.1>` for more
  884. details on these changes.
  885. * ``AdminSite.root()``. This method of hooking up the admin URLs will be
  886. removed in favor of including ``admin.site.urls``.
  887. * Authentication backends need to define the boolean attributes
  888. ``supports_object_permissions`` and ``supports_anonymous_user`` until
  889. version 1.4, at which point it will be assumed that all backends will
  890. support these options.
